Abstract

We analyze the capability of the next generation of linear electron-positron colliders to unravel the spin and couplings of excited leptons predicted by composite models. Assuming that these machines will be able to operate both in the e+e- and e-γ modes, we study the effects of the excited electrons of spin 1/2 and 3/2 in the reactions e-γ → e-γ and e+e- → γγ. We show how the use of polarized beams is able not only to increase the reach of these machines, but also to determine the spin and couplings of the excited states.
